    LED panel type for QE75Q60RAT

    Hi,

    I'm trying to repair 75" QE75Q60RAT with a faulty main AV board after a lightning strike.
    I got a main board for 55" QE55RU8000 which works in this TV but the picture is bright with very low contrast.
    In the service manu I have changed LED panel type to 75" 75L1AU0NR but that didn't help, unfortunately.

    Could you let me know which panel type is in the service menu for this model?

    TV is based on CY-RR075FGHV1H

    I would be very grateful

    Best regards
    Marek

    Here you need to carefully compare the boards, there are positional resistors (they can be set to different panel diagonals) and you need to rearrange the spi flash 25Q80 from your native motherboard, this flash T-CON, it contains all the settings for your panel...

          Indeed I have found many differences between those mainboards.
          Unfortunately, after I changed several resistors, removed one DC/DC regulator swapped 25Q80 flash, board works worse than before.
          TV does power cycle with backlight only, no even logo displayed.
